Output 850623e86ae1d29af31933d91e6676766e94de2587cc33f90d23a23732d1264e:1

value
19346428
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 43ded2a7e4c0e362f45150159a1f6ba75b7b7d4877a69edaf014876a81c879af
address
bc1pg00d9flycr3k9az32q2e58mt5adhkl2gw7nfakhszjrk4qwg0xhs46xmf0
transaction
850623e86ae1d29af31933d91e6676766e94de2587cc33f90d23a23732d1264e
spent
true